NetApp Names Datalink Healthcare Partner of the Year



Datalink, a provider of data center infrastructure and services, has been named Healthcare Partner of the Year by NetApp at its recent United States Public Sector (USPS) Partner Summit. The company has been recognized for its strong revenue performance and support of NetApp-based storage and virtual data center infrastructures for healthcare organizations throughout the United States.

“We are naming Datalink the Healthcare Partner of the Year to recognize Datalink’s proven leadership in designing agile solutions for both the payer and provider healthcare markets,” said David Nesvisky, senior director, NetApp Healthcare. “This is the first award presented to a channel partner since the inception of our healthcare practice in 2010. Datalink sales, design, and support of comprehensive IT solutions for our joint healthcare constituents have been exemplary.”

“We are pleased to be recognized by NetApp for our strong performance in the healthcare industry,” commented Datalink President and CEO Paul Lidsky. “Healthcare organizations are under intense pressure to drive greater efficiency, gain competitive advantage, and enhance patient care. Datalink has a proven track record of helping healthcare organizations optimize IT to facilitate the achievement of these goals.”

Datalink recently announced a major expansion of its managed services portfolio with the addition of unified monitoring and managed infrastructure services for virtual data centers (VDCs). The new services enable organizations that utilize Datalink to design and deploy next-generation VDC architectures to also outsource 24x7 monitoring, reporting, operating, and troubleshooting of all components to Datalink's dedicated managed services staff.
